use larger number fo builds for comment tempalting tests
Signed-off-by: Jakub Sokołowski <jakub@status.im>
This commit is contained in:
parent
bc0666b3cc
commit
47ab9a83b4
|
@ -12,28 +12,35 @@ const COMMENT = `
|
|||
### Jenkins Builds
|
||||
| :grey_question: | Commit | :hash: | Finished (UTC) | Duration | Platform | Result |
|
||||
|-|-|-|-|-|-|-|
|
||||
| :heavy_check_mark: | COMMIT-1 | [ID-1](URL-1) | 2018-12-20 08:26:33 | DURATION-1 | \`PLATFORM-1\` | [:package: package](PKG_URL-1) |
|
||||
| | | | | | | |
|
||||
| :x: | COMMIT-2 | [ID-2](URL-2) | 2018-12-20 08:45:28 | DURATION-2 | \`PLATFORM-2\` | [:page_facing_up: build log](URL-2consoleText) |
|
||||
| :heavy_check_mark: | COMMIT-0 | [ID-1](URL-1) | 2018-12-20 08:25:56 | DURATION-1 | \`PLATFORM-1\` | [:package: package](PKG_URL-1) |
|
||||
| :heavy_check_mark: | COMMIT-0 | [ID-2](URL-2) | 2018-12-20 08:26:53 | DURATION-2 | \`PLATFORM-2\` | [:package: package](PKG_URL-2) |
|
||||
`
|
||||
|
||||
const COMMENT_FOLDED = `
|
||||
### Jenkins Builds
|
||||
<details>
|
||||
<summary>Click to see older builds (2)</summary>
|
||||
<summary>Click to see older builds (7)</summary>
|
||||
|
||||
| :grey_question: | Commit | :hash: | Finished (UTC) | Duration | Platform | Result |
|
||||
|-|-|-|-|-|-|-|
|
||||
| :heavy_check_mark: | COMMIT-1 | [ID-1](URL-1) | 2018-12-20 08:26:33 | DURATION-1 | \`PLATFORM-1\` | [:package: package](PKG_URL-1) |
|
||||
| :heavy_check_mark: | COMMIT-0 | [ID-1](URL-1) | 2018-12-20 08:25:56 | DURATION-1 | \`PLATFORM-1\` | [:package: package](PKG_URL-1) |
|
||||
| :heavy_check_mark: | COMMIT-0 | [ID-2](URL-2) | 2018-12-20 08:26:53 | DURATION-2 | \`PLATFORM-2\` | [:package: package](PKG_URL-2) |
|
||||
| :x: | COMMIT-0 | [ID-3](URL-3) | 2018-12-20 08:27:50 | DURATION-3 | \`PLATFORM-3\` | [:page_facing_up: build log](URL-3consoleText) |
|
||||
| | | | | | | |
|
||||
| :x: | COMMIT-2 | [ID-2](URL-2) | 2018-12-20 08:45:28 | DURATION-2 | \`PLATFORM-2\` | [:page_facing_up: build log](URL-2consoleText) |
|
||||
| :heavy_check_mark: | COMMIT-1 | [ID-4](URL-4) | 2018-12-20 08:28:47 | DURATION-4 | \`PLATFORM-4\` | [:package: package](PKG_URL-4) |
|
||||
| :heavy_check_mark: | COMMIT-1 | [ID-5](URL-5) | 2018-12-20 08:29:43 | DURATION-5 | \`PLATFORM-5\` | [:package: package](PKG_URL-5) |
|
||||
| :x: | COMMIT-1 | [ID-6](URL-6) | 2018-12-20 08:30:40 | DURATION-6 | \`PLATFORM-6\` | [:page_facing_up: build log](URL-6consoleText) |
|
||||
| :heavy_check_mark: | COMMIT-1 | [ID-7](URL-7) | 2018-12-20 08:31:37 | DURATION-7 | \`PLATFORM-7\` | [:package: package](PKG_URL-7) |
|
||||
</details>
|
||||
|
||||
| :grey_question: | Commit | :hash: | Finished (UTC) | Duration | Platform | Result |
|
||||
|-|-|-|-|-|-|-|
|
||||
| :heavy_check_mark: | COMMIT-3 | [ID-3](URL-3) | 2018-12-20 08:26:32 | DURATION-3 | \`PLATFORM-3\` | [:package: package](PKG_URL-3) |
|
||||
| :heavy_check_mark: | COMMIT-2 | [ID-8](URL-8) | 2018-12-20 08:32:34 | DURATION-8 | \`PLATFORM-8\` | [:package: package](PKG_URL-8) |
|
||||
| :x: | COMMIT-2 | [ID-9](URL-9) | 2018-12-20 08:33:31 | DURATION-9 | \`PLATFORM-9\` | [:page_facing_up: build log](URL-9consoleText) |
|
||||
| :heavy_check_mark: | COMMIT-2 | [ID-10](URL-10) | 2018-12-20 08:34:27 | DURATION-10 | \`PLATFORM-10\` | [:package: package](PKG_URL-10) |
|
||||
| :heavy_check_mark: | COMMIT-2 | [ID-11](URL-11) | 2018-12-20 08:35:24 | DURATION-11 | \`PLATFORM-11\` | [:package: package](PKG_URL-11) |
|
||||
| | | | | | | |
|
||||
| :x: | COMMIT-4 | [ID-4](URL-4) | 2018-12-20 08:45:23 | DURATION-4 | \`PLATFORM-4\` | [:page_facing_up: build log](URL-4consoleText) |
|
||||
| :x: | COMMIT-3 | [ID-12](URL-12) | 2018-12-20 08:36:21 | DURATION-12 | \`PLATFORM-12\` | [:page_facing_up: build log](URL-12consoleText) |
|
||||
`
|
||||
|
||||
describe('Comments', () => {
|
||||
|
|
|
@ -9,48 +9,18 @@ const BUILD = {
|
|||
pkg_url: 'https://example.com/some/pkg/path',
|
||||
}
|
||||
|
||||
const BUILDS = [
|
||||
{
|
||||
id: 'ID-1',
|
||||
commit: 'COMMIT-1',
|
||||
success: true,
|
||||
platform: 'PLATFORM-1',
|
||||
duration: 'DURATION-1',
|
||||
url: 'URL-1',
|
||||
pkg_url: 'PKG_URL-1',
|
||||
meta: { created: 1545294393058 },
|
||||
},
|
||||
{
|
||||
id: 'ID-2',
|
||||
commit: 'COMMIT-2',
|
||||
success: false,
|
||||
platform: 'PLATFORM-2',
|
||||
duration: 'DURATION-2',
|
||||
url: 'URL-2',
|
||||
pkg_url: 'PKG_URL-2',
|
||||
meta: { created: 1545295528896 },
|
||||
},
|
||||
{
|
||||
id: 'ID-3',
|
||||
commit: 'COMMIT-3',
|
||||
success: true,
|
||||
platform: 'PLATFORM-3',
|
||||
duration: 'DURATION-3',
|
||||
url: 'URL-3',
|
||||
pkg_url: 'PKG_URL-3',
|
||||
meta: { created: 1545294392930 },
|
||||
},
|
||||
{
|
||||
id: 'ID-4',
|
||||
commit: 'COMMIT-4',
|
||||
success: false,
|
||||
platform: 'PLATFORM-4',
|
||||
duration: 'DURATION-4',
|
||||
url: 'URL-4',
|
||||
pkg_url: 'PKG_URL-4',
|
||||
meta: { created: 1545295523333 },
|
||||
},
|
||||
]
|
||||
const getBuild = (idx) => ({
|
||||
id: `ID-${idx}`,
|
||||
commit: `COMMIT-${Math.floor(idx/4)}`,
|
||||
success: (idx%3) ? true : false,
|
||||
platform: `PLATFORM-${idx}`,
|
||||
duration: `DURATION-${idx}`,
|
||||
url: `URL-${idx}`,
|
||||
pkg_url: `PKG_URL-${idx}`,
|
||||
meta: { created: 1545294300000+(idx*56789) },
|
||||
})
|
||||
|
||||
const BUILDS = Array.apply(null, Array(12)).map((v,i)=>getBuild(i+1))
|
||||
|
||||
const COMMENTS = [
|
||||
{ pr: 'PR-1', comment_id: 1234 },
|
||||
|
|
Loading…
Reference in New Issue